#427560 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#427560 is composed of 25.9% red, 45.9%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.9% yellow and 54.1% black. It has a hue angle of 155.3 degrees, a saturation of 27.9% and a lightness of 35.9%. #427560 color hex could be obtained by blending #84eac0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

● #427560 color description : Mostly desaturated dark cyan - lime green.
#427560 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#427560 has RGB values of R:66, G:117,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0.44, M:0, Y:0.18, K:0.54. Its decimal value is 4355424.

Shades and Tints of #427560
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020403 is the darkest color, while #f7faf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#427560
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#57605c is the less saturated color, while #03b46b is the most saturated one.
